## Formula sandbox tuning

User-supplied formulas in Gridmoor execute inside a restricted interpreter with hard ceilings on time, memory, and call depth. Reviewers should confirm any change to these ceilings is justified in the PR description, since raising them widens the abuse surface. Defaults were chosen from production traces. The current limits are as follows.

limits module of tafog-fawip:
WEIGHTS = {
    "julix": 57,
    "lamys": 992,
    "kasvan": 209,
    "quenok": 750,
    "alddor": 259,
    "oliath": 1009,
    "wenix": 815,
}

**Vendor note: Inkmill markdown pipeline**

Rendering for Parchway docs is outsourced to Inkmill under an annual contract, renewing each March. They handle sanitization and PDF export; we own the upload queue. SLA: 4-hour response on rendering failures. Escalate only after two failed retries. Their support desk is reachable at the address below.

billing contact of hahaf-baguf = zorael.tammir.jorius@sivrelhq.internal

Subject: Retirement of the Ashfell Product Line

Dear Executive Team,

Following careful review, we will retire the Ashfell line by the end of the fiscal year. Finance should begin winding down associated inventory provisions and reallocating the maintenance budget to the Corvid platform. Customer migration costs are estimated and modest. The strategic rationale is captured in the confidential note appended below.

board note of kageg-bahof: The renewal with Holwynax Holdings closes at $2 million a year, 5 percent below the last contract. Project Ulaath slips by two quarters because of the supplier delay.

Hi Tomas — quick handover before the weekly sync on Gatewright rate limiting. I moved us from fixed windows to sliding-log buckets; the config lives in `limits.yaml` and reloads hot. Watch the burst multiplier — finance's batch jobs tripped it twice last week, so I bumped their tier. Dashboards are wired up, alerts still need tuning. One admin thing: the limiter's override console re-locked itself after the redeploy, and you'll need the recovery passphrase to get back in. Here it is.

recovery phrase for bawef-kagug: casix-tamvan-lamath-holeth-gilmir-drudor-julax-wenok-wenael-rusvan-holax-goriel-frawyn